当前位置: 首页 > news >正文

PrusaSlicer终极指南:10个专业技巧快速掌握免费3D打印切片软件

PrusaSlicer终极指南:10个专业技巧快速掌握免费3D打印切片软件

【免费下载链接】PrusaSlicerG-code generator for 3D printers (RepRap, Makerbot, Ultimaker etc.)项目地址: https://gitcode.com/gh_mirrors/pr/PrusaSlicer

PrusaSlicer是一款功能强大的免费开源3D打印切片软件,能够将3D模型转换为打印机可识别的G-code指令。这款专业的切片工具支持RepRap、Makerbot、Ultimaker等多种主流3D打印机,提供完整的打印参数配置和优化功能。无论你是3D打印新手还是专业用户,PrusaSlicer都能帮助你实现高质量的打印效果。

🎨 从零开始:快速上手PrusaSlicer

想要立即开始使用这款强大的3D打印切片软件?只需从官方仓库克隆项目:

git clone https://gitcode.com/gh_mirrors/pr/PrusaSlicer

PrusaSlicer支持Windows、macOS和Linux三大平台,无需额外依赖即可运行。软件采用C++编写,核心功能封装在libslic3r库中,命令行界面则是该库的轻量级封装。这意味着你可以通过命令行批量处理切片任务,实现自动化工作流程。

PrusaSlicer的G-code预览功能 - 在实际打印前检查每一层的打印路径和填充效果

🔧 实战技巧:提升打印质量的关键设置

接缝位置优化:隐藏瑕疵的艺术

3D打印中的接缝是每层开始和结束的位置,如果处理不当会严重影响美观。PrusaSlicer提供了智能的接缝优化算法,通过角落惩罚函数自动选择最佳接缝位置。

角落惩罚函数数学模型 - PrusaSlicer通过这个算法智能选择接缝位置,显著提升打印表面质量

应用场景:打印圆柱形物体或曲面模型时,将接缝设置为"最近"或"对齐"模式,配合角落惩罚函数,可以使接缝几乎不可见。对于功能性零件,可以考虑将接缝放置在非关键受力区域。

多材料打印配置:解锁创意无限可能

PrusaSlicer支持多挤出机打印,这意味着你可以在同一打印作业中使用不同颜色或材质的耗材。软件内置了智能的换料逻辑和温度控制,确保不同材料之间的过渡平滑。

核心配置技巧

  • src/libslic3r/目录下的核心模块中,可以找到多材料处理的完整逻辑
  • 为每个挤出机单独设置温度、回抽和流速参数
  • 利用"擦嘴塔"功能减少颜色污染

📊 效率提升:智能配置管理策略

配置快照:一键切换打印参数

不同的打印任务需要不同的参数设置。PrusaSlicer的配置快照功能让你可以保存多套完整的打印配置,包括层高、填充密度、支撑设置等,实现快速切换。

配置快照对话框 - 轻松管理和切换不同版本的打印参数设置,提高工作效率

实战应用:为不同材料(PLA、PETG、ABS)创建独立的配置快照,每个快照包含材料特定的温度、冷却和速度设置。这样在切换材料时,只需激活对应的快照即可,无需手动调整数十个参数。

打印机配置文件:兼容性无忧

PrusaSlicer支持市场上绝大多数3D打印机品牌,包括Anycubic、Artillery、Voron等主流型号。每个品牌都有专门的配置文件,确保最佳兼容性。

Anycubic品牌打印机配置 - PrusaSlicer为各品牌提供优化的预设参数,确保打印质量

Artillery打印机打印床纹理 - 精确的打印区域定义确保模型正确放置

🚀 专家级配置:高级功能深度挖掘

自定义G-code脚本:实现个性化打印流程

PrusaSlicer允许在打印开始、层变更、打印结束等关键节点插入自定义G-code脚本。这个功能对于高级用户来说价值巨大。

实用脚本示例

  • 打印开始前执行床面清洁或喷嘴擦拭
  • 每层打印后执行特定温度调整
  • 打印结束后自动关闭加热器和风扇

相关实现代码可在src/GCode/目录中找到,这里包含了完整的G-code生成和解析逻辑。

支撑结构优化:减少后处理工作量

支撑结构是3D打印中的必要之恶,但PrusaSlicer提供了多种优化选项来减少其负面影响:

  1. 树状支撑:接触点更少,更容易移除
  2. 可溶性支撑:使用PVA等可溶性材料
  3. 支撑界面层:在支撑和模型之间添加特殊层,便于分离

🛠️ 故障排除:常见问题解决方案

第一层粘附问题

如果模型无法牢固粘附在打印床上,可以尝试以下调整:

  • 检查床面平整度并重新校准
  • 调整第一层挤出宽度和高度
  • 启用"裙边"或"边缘"功能
  • 调整床面温度(PLA:60°C,PETG:80°C)

层间结合力不足

层间结合力弱会导致打印件容易断裂:

  • 适当提高打印温度(增加5-10°C)
  • 降低冷却风扇速度
  • 检查挤出机校准,确保挤出量准确

💡 专业技巧:提升打印成功率

模型修复与预处理

PrusaSlicer内置了强大的STL修复功能,可以自动修复常见的模型问题:

  • 非流形边缘
  • 重叠面片
  • 方向错误的面片

在导入复杂模型前,建议先使用软件的"修复"功能,这可以避免切片过程中的各种奇怪问题。

填充模式选择策略

不同的填充模式适用于不同的应用场景:

  • 网格填充:通用选择,平衡强度和打印时间
  • 蜂窝填充:最高强度,但打印时间较长
  • 直线填充:快速打印,适用于非承重部件
  • 同心填充:适合柔性材料和透明材料

📈 性能优化:加快切片速度

PrusaSlicer支持多线程处理,可以充分利用现代多核CPU的性能。在设置中调整以下参数可以显著提升切片速度:

  1. 降低切片分辨率:对于大型模型,适当降低分辨率
  2. 简化模型:在导入前使用3D建模软件简化网格
  3. 禁用不必要的预览:切片过程中关闭实时预览

🔍 扩展功能:第三方插件与脚本

虽然PrusaSlicer功能已经非常全面,但社区还开发了许多有用的扩展:

  • 批量处理脚本:自动化处理多个模型文件
  • 自定义后处理工具:G-code优化和验证
  • 打印机配置文件分享平台:获取其他用户优化的参数

🎯 总结:PrusaSlicer的核心优势

PrusaSlicer之所以成为3D打印爱好者和专业人士的首选,主要得益于以下几个特点:

  1. 完全免费开源:无需付费即可享受所有专业功能
  2. 广泛兼容性:支持绝大多数主流3D打印机
  3. 智能参数优化:自动调整打印设置,提高成功率
  4. 活跃社区支持:持续更新和改进

通过掌握本文介绍的技巧和策略,你将能够充分发挥PrusaSlicer的强大功能,显著提升3D打印的质量和效率。无论是简单的原型制作还是复杂的多材料打印,PrusaSlicer都能提供专业的解决方案。

记住,3D打印的成功不仅取决于硬件,切片软件的选择和配置同样关键。PrusaSlicer作为业界领先的免费切片工具,值得每一位3D打印爱好者深入学习和使用。

【免费下载链接】PrusaSlicerG-code generator for 3D printers (RepRap, Makerbot, Ultimaker etc.)项目地址: https://gitcode.com/gh_mirrors/pr/PrusaSlicer

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.cnnetsun.cn/news/2793342.html

相关文章:

  • 从编译配置到功能清单:如何读懂FFmpeg的-buildconf输出并定制你的版本
  • 为什么Digital是学习数字电路的终极免费工具?完整指南
  • 告别Transformer的OOM噩梦:手把手教你用Informer搞定超长电力负荷预测(附ETDataset实战代码)
  • 如何用BilibiliDown轻松下载B站无损音频:新手完全指南
  • 不止是画图:用MATLAB分析重复控制器性能,Q值和周期N到底怎么调?
  • 【原创解锁】Craiyon绘画[特殊字符]解锁会员[特殊字符]无限AI绘画生图
  • PCIe设备上电后如何‘握手’?一文搞懂Receiver Detect检测机制
  • 告别网格焦虑:用ANSYS ICEM的O-Block和Index Control高效搞定汽车复杂外形的结构网格
  • CSDN AI数字营销与二维码共存真相:基于V3.2.7后台源码逆向分析的7层内容校验逻辑
  • ThinkPad终极散热指南:3个简单步骤实现智能风扇控制与噪音优化
  • 模拟芯片行业并购深度解析:从TI收购国家半导体看产业格局演变
  • Source Han Serif CN 7字重开源字体终极实战指南:从技术架构到深度应用
  • 微软 BitNet 在 x86/ARM CPU 上实现 2–6 倍推理加速、70–80%+ 能耗下降,并可在单颗 CPU 上运行 100B 参数 BitNet b1.58 模型
  • Coraza WAF技术架构深度解析:Go语言构建的企业级Web应用防火墙实现原理
  • 从单片机到ARM嵌入式开发:环境搭建、裸机编程与Linux驱动入门
  • 3步告别字幕延迟:FFSubSync智能同步工具的终极指南
  • CSDN AI营销看板关键词排名功能解析(官方未公开的埋点逻辑与替代方案)
  • 别再手动写URDF了!用SolidWorks插件一键导出机器人模型到ROS(附避坑指南)
  • 2026论文降AIGC网站:11款工具实测谁配“靠谱”二字?
  • 变量多样性诊断:从数据类型到语义一致性的四维实战指南
  • Python求职数据采集与可视化分析工具包(Flask+SQLite+爬虫)
  • 医用超声图像模拟系统探头建模详细设计
  • 【计算机组成原理】 微操作与微命令详解
  • Scribd电子书离线下载终极指南:3步打造个人数字图书馆
  • 告别重复编码,用快马AI智能生成高效异步爬虫提升开发效率
  • 手把手教你用CH340E自制USB转TTL串口模块(附Python测试代码与PCB文件)
  • 深度解析Obsidian Execute Code插件:构建多语言代码执行架构与高效工作流
  • H5+ Barcode扫一扫进阶:除了扫码,还能识别本地图片和开关闪光灯(完整代码解析)
  • 解决Quartus II JTAG下载错误84:BIOS并口设置是关键
  • 逆向工程的艺术:如何深度解析微信小程序包结构